Is CHEMICAL TRANSFER COMPANY safe to load? CHEMICAL TRANSFER COMPANY (USDOT 269372, MC-188232) is an active asset-based motor carrier based in STOCKTON, CA, operating 231 power units and 211 drivers. Operating authority has been active 40 years (past the 24-month broker-confidence threshold). Across 287 roadside inspections, its vehicle out-of-service rate is 13.2% (below the 22.26% national average), with 3 reportable crashes in the last 24 months. FMCSA rates it Satisfactory. Vektor rates it clear to load (88/100), with the leading concern: fatal crash on record. Source: FMCSA SAFER/MCMIS, last updated 2026-06-21.
